Course Overview

The Master of Energy Geoscience at the University of Western Australia is designed for aspiring geoscientists ready to tackle the complex challenges of modern energy exploration and production, with a forward-looking emphasis on sustainable energy futures. You will delve into critical areas such as petroleum systems, basin analysis, and near-surface geophysics, gaining the specialised knowledge required to understand and characterise subsurface environments. This postgraduate degree is ideal for those seeking to build advanced technical expertise in energy geoscience, preparing you for impactful roles in a vital global industry.

This Master of Energy Geoscience is studied full-time on campus over two years, integrating rigorous coursework with practical application. You will explore advanced topics including structural analysis for energy geoscience and the transition to low-carbon energy solutions, alongside units in ethical scientific communication. Depending on your chosen pathway, you will undertake a significant research project or a dissertation, applying your skills to real-world problems. Graduates will be equipped with advanced analytical capabilities and a deep understanding of energy systems, ready for careers in resource exploration, environmental assessment, and the evolving energy sector.

Program Overview

The Master of Energy Geoscience program provides a comprehensive understanding of subsurface characterization, basin analysis, and structural geology, with a focus on applications in the energy sector and a low-carbon future. Students will explore near-surface geophysics, petroleum systems, and tectonic frameworks of the Indo-Pacific region. The curriculum also includes a significant research project and offers elective options in areas such as climate geoscience, economics, remote sensing, and critical metal resources, preparing graduates for diverse roles in the evolving energy landscape.

1 Core

Near-surface and environmental geophysics
Tectonics of Australia in the Indo-Pacific
Petroleum systems and subsurface characterisation
Basin analysis techniques
Advanced energy geoscience for a low carbon future
Structural analysis for energy geoscience
Sedimentary basin field excursion
Ethical conduct and communication of science

2 Core

Masters research project in geoscience part 1
Masters research project in geoscience part 2
Masters research project in geoscience part 3
Masters research project in geoscience part 4

3 Option

Climate, energy and water economics
Remote sensing of the environment
Geographic information systems applications
Advanced spatial and environmental modelling
Fossil to future – the transition
Climate geoscience
Multiscale tectonic systems
Critical metal resources
Marine geoscience
Geoscience internship
